How to Promote Affiliate Links

If you’re an affiliate, you need to know how to promote affiliate links properly. The first step is to look at the offer and see if there are any restrictions. Once you know how to advertise affiliate links in accordance with the advertiser’s terms, you can use the methods below to generate traffic.

What Is An Affiliate Link?

An affiliate link is a link to a product, service or other offer that you can promote. When you promote these links, you’ll receive a commission. The commission is how you generate revenue.

These links are provided by a product or service owner.

You help generate sales and earn a hefty commission in the process. Large and small businesses use affiliates to generate more sales. Even Amazon has an affiliate program with the massive amount of traffic that they generate.

Top 20 Ways to Promote Your Affiliate Links

If you want to promote affiliate links, there are more than enough ways to get traffic to the link.

    1. Advertising. Promote affiliate links through advertising, whether it’s a direct link to the offer or a link back to a landing page you’ve created. Advertising terms should be outlined for you, and some offers may not allow direct advertising.
    2. Blog posts. A great way to promote affiliate links is through the content on a blog. Create relevant posts and websites for your niche. When you create educational blog posts, you can often drive traffic to an offer.
    3. Reviews. If you’re selling a product, you can create reviews of the product. The reviews will convert at a high rate and also reach prospects that are past the educational phase.
    4. Email. Do you have an email list that is highly responsive? You may be able to send them links through an email sequence that can generate sales.
    5. Video. A lot of YouTube videos are available that review products and make sales from the link in the description. Video content is very engaging and has a much higher chance of being able to make a sale.
    6. Guest Posts. If you’re lucky enough to land a guest post opportunity on an industry leading site, you can generate sales on the back of the traffic the site provides. Guest posting is powerful, but be sure that you can add in an affiliate link.
    7. Facebook ads. An effective way to earn money through your affiliate links is to place advertisements on Facebook. The great thing about Facebook ads is that you can advertise to very specific groups of people within your target market. This allows you to generate highly targeted leads and conversions.
    8. Facebook groups. If you don’t want to pay for ads, you may be able to promote your affiliate links in Facebook groups. Like ads, Facebook groups appeal to very specific groups of people. Some of these groups have very specific topics, so you have a very narrowly-focused niche, Facebook groups are a great way to get your name in front of the right people.
    9. Facebook posts. If you have a following on Facebook, you can promote your affiliate links through your posts on this social platform. Your followers will see these posts in their feeds and will be more likely to click on your links because they trust your personal brand.
    10. Instagram posts. Instagram’s visual nature makes it a great platform for promoting your affiliate links. You can post your links in the caption of your photos, your bio or even in your stories. The new Reels feature gives affiliates a new opportunity to promote products through enticing videos.
    11. Twitter. With more than 300 million users, Twitter can be a great platform to promote your affiliate links on. But you’ll need to get creative to make this social network work for you. Sharing content that contains your affiliate link is one effective way. 
    12. Contests. People love free things, and they love winning things. Hosting a contest is a great way to promote your brand, expand your following and promote your affiliate offers. They generate a lot of buzz, which means there are more opportunities to drive traffic to your offers.
    13. EBooks. Many affiliate marketers offer free eBooks in exchange for signing up for their newsletter. Others create and sell eBooks. In either case, this is a great place to promote your affiliate links. Because an eBook can cover a wide range of topics, affiliates can promote multiple offers. 
    14. Quora. A popular platform for asking questions, Quora is a great opportunity for you to answer questions, build your credibility and share your affiliate links. 
    15. Reddit. One of the most popular websites on the internet, Reddit has subreddits (a type of forum) for virtually every subject on the planet. No matter your niche or how narrow your niche is, you are sure to find your target audience on Reddit. You’ll need to be careful about sharing links here. Promoting affiliate links is frowned upon on most subreddits, so make sure that you understand the rules before posting.
    16. Webinar. A webinar is a great opportunity to build your brand, demonstrate your expertise in your niche, build your credibility and promote to your target audience. Those who sign up for your webinar are already interested in what you’re selling, so it will be much easier to generate leads and conversions.
    17. SlideShare. A platform that allows you to share presentations, SlideShare is a great way to educate your audience while promoting your affiliate links. Offering valuable content is the key to success here.
    18. Podcasts. One of the most popular forms of content available are podcasts. This form of advertising takes a lot of work, but if you build an industry podcast, you can promote links on your show or provide resources in your podcast’s description.
    19. Forum. Promoting on forums is one of the best and worst ways to promote affiliate links. Join forums, provide great advice, and if you’re allowed, add affiliate links to a post or in your signature.
    20. Guides. Create guides or educational courses that can help nurture leads. Add in links that are relevant to the guide’s subject matter.
